Solve:
3x−5 = 9.
A. x = −3
B.x = 2
C.x = 7
D.x = 8

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]3x-5=9[/tex]

[tex]3x-5+5=9+5[/tex]

[tex]3x=14[/tex]

[tex]\frac{3x}{3}=\frac{14}{3}[/tex]

[tex]x=\frac{14}{3}[/tex]

x ≈ 4.66667
